Worn with a Purpose: Ajinomoto Launches Sustainable Uniforms from Recycled Bottles 

Ajinomoto Philippines Corporation Champions Sustainability with New Field Sales Uniforms Made from Recycled Plastic Bottles

Ajinomoto Philippines Corporation (APC) takes another meaningful and purposeful stride towards their mission on sustainability as they unveil their newest initiative: the rollout of eco-conscious uniforms for over 400 field personnel, made with meaning in every thread, using recycled materials. An innovative initiative that reflects APC’s commitment, the uniforms are poised to be a tangible and replicable daily reminder, inside and outside APC facilities of their commitment to reducing plastic waste and promoting a circular economy. 

Together with its partner Custom Sports and Leisure Manufacturing Corp. (CSL), APC gathered, transformed, and produced approximately 7,005 plastic bottles into high-quality, breathable uniforms that support both performance and environmental responsibility. 

“More than just a uniform update, this is APC’s commitment to our unwavering commitment to responsible business practices, and our long-term sustainability roadmap,” said Ernie Carlos, APC’s Chief Sustainability Officer and Director for Supply Chain. “Our field sales team now wears not just our brand, but our values.”

As APC’s trusted partner, CSL emphasized the measurable impact of the collaboration. According to CSL Corporate Secretary Adam Clark, garments made from recycled polyester can reduce energy consumption by up to 60% compared to those made with virgin polyester, translating to significant reductions in greenhouse gas emissions. “Our fabrics are made with 14% certified recycled plastic per shirt. We collect from recycling programs, drop-off centers, and waste facilities to give discarded bottles a renewed purpose,” he added.

This initiative supports APC Group’s broader 2030 sustainability goals: reducing its environmental impact by half while engaging communities, employees, and partners in sustainable transformation. It also comes at a critical time, with global organizations like the World Economic Forum warning of alarming plastic pollution levels — an issue APC addresses by diverting plastic waste from landfills and oceans into practical everyday solutions.

Through this campaign, Ajinomoto Philippines once again proves that sustainability doesn’t have to be separate from operations — it can be worn proudly, every day, by the very people who bring the brand closer to Filipino households.
